在build方法中使用CircularProgressIndicator组件来创建圆形进度条。可以通过设置value属性来指定进度的百分比,取值范围为0.0到1.0,或者通过设置isIndeterminate属性为true来展示模糊的进度指示器。 以下是一个简单的例子: 代码语言:txt 复制 @override Widget build(BuildContext context) { return Scaffold( appBar: AppBar(...
以下是一个简单的 Flutter 应用,其中包含一个LinearProgressIndicator和一个CircularProgressIndicator。 import 'package:flutter/material.dart'; void main() { runApp( MaterialApp( debugShowCheckedModeBanner: false, home: Scaffold( appBar: AppBar(title: const Text('Progress Indicators')), body: const ...
"https://upload.wikimedia.org/wikipedia/commons/thumb/9/9a/Visual_Studio_Code_1.35_icon.svg/...
height: _progressBarSize, child: Stack( children: [if(progress >=0) SizedBox( width: _progressBarSize, height: _progressBarSize, child: TweenAnimationBuilder<double>( tween: Tween<double>(begin:0.0, end: progress), duration:constDuration(milliseconds:50), builder: (c, v, _) => CircularP...
一统天下 flutter - widget 进度类: CircularProgressIndicator - 圆形进度条 示例如下: lib\widget\progress\circular_progress_indicator.dart /* * CircularProgressIndicator - 圆形进度条 */import'package:flutter/material.dart';classCircularProgressIndicatorDemoextendsStatefulWidget{ ...
这样我们创建一个Listenable的DownloadController对象,然后把DownloadButton用AnimatedBuilder封装起来,就可以实时监测到downloadStatus和downloadProgress的变化了。 如下所示: Widget build(BuildContext context) { return Scaffold( appBar: AppBar(title: const Text('下载按钮')), ...
new Container( height: 60.0, child: new Center(child: new CircularProgressIndicator()), ) - Md. Habibur Rahman 2 这里的 Center 小部件也是必不可少的。起初我忘了加它,结果 CircularProgressIndicator 仍然扩展到整个屏幕。 - Rivers Cuomo网页...
Code for Creating Circular Progress Bar in Flutter import 'package:flutter/material.dart'; void main() { runApp(const MyApp()); } class MyApp extends StatelessWidget { const MyApp({super.key}); @override Widget build(BuildContext context) { ...
ButtonBarTheme 11. Material Spacer Visibility IndexedStack CircleAvatar 1. 进度指示器 LinearProgressIndicator、CircularProgressIndicator 精确进度指示(可计算/预估,如:文件下载)、模糊进度指示(如:下拉刷新、数据提交)。 没提供尺寸参数(以父容器尺寸作为绘制边界),可通过ConstrainedBox、SizedBox等尺寸限制类组件来指定...
五、ProgressBar 在Flutter中进度条父类:ProgressIndicator,它有两个子类 LinearProgressIndicator和CircularProgressIndicator 使用起来非常简单 new LinearProgressIndicator()//水平进度加载圈 new CircularProgressIndicator()//圆形加载圈 我贴出来圆形圈圈效果,和android效果一致: 0 六、ScrollView 1.CustomScrollView 允许您直...